MEET ANGIE.
Angie (Engelbert) Fowler is an opportunity architect who thrives on helping others reach their full potential. With over a decade of experience in learning and development, she has honed her expertise in designing dynamic training programs, fostering inclusive environments, and empowering individuals to achieve their goals. Whether leading global learning initiatives, mentoring emerging leaders, or collaborating with diverse teams or students, Angie’s passion lies in equipping people with the tools and strategies they need to succeed.
Angie’s journey has been as creative as it is impactful. From touring the U.S. as Lucy in The Chronicles of Narnia to performing with the improv troupe Musical the Musical, her ability to connect with audiences has shaped her approach to engagement and storytelling. She wrote, directed, and produced an award-winning short film that screened at international festivals, proving her belief in creating opportunities and crafting compelling narratives.
